I have a Crosshair VII Hero and a 2700x. All drivers, OS and bios are up to date as of this posting. I normally have AA as my post code after everything has fired up but in the process of enabling fTPM I now get code 33 after it boots. I've contacted ASUS and they said that they cannot determine why the code changed. Secure Boot is enabled and CSM is disabled. The machine still works fine so I'm not so much worried about the code rather than I'm curious as to why it changed. I've reseated the CPU, RAM, GPU, and it still shows 33. Now if I disable fTPM, it goes back to AA which is what it has always shown in the 3yrs since I built it. From what I gather the 33 code is a CPU Post Memory Initialization code but I've even swapped DIMMs with another PC in the house and it still showed 33, unless I disable the fTPM of course. The first thing ASUS said to do was reset the bios which did get rid of the 33 but that's only because it disables fTPM by default so that wasn't the solution.
